17:49-2. Applicability of laws governing insurance corporations
Every person, partnership or association receiving any such certificate shall be subject to the insurance laws of this State and to the jurisdiction and supervision of the Commissioner of Banking and Insurance in the same manner as if an insurance corporation organized upon the stock plan pursuant to the laws of this State, and authorized to do the business of insurance specified in the certificate.
L.1939, c. 188, p. 544, s. 2.
